Analysis
In 2011, control of corruption in Sao Tome and Principe stood at 0.2293 standard error.
The figure is down 0.5% on the previous year and down 29.5% over ten years.
Over the whole period, control of corruption in Sao Tome and Principe peaked at 0.5569 standard error in 1996 and was at its lowest, 0.2266 standard error, in 2006.
That places Sao Tome and Principe 4th out of 53 countries with data for 2011, putting it in the top 10%.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 13 years of available data.

About this data
See definition GV.CONT.CO.ES. Inherent to all Governance Indicators is a margin of error, which might vary from country to country, normally attributable to two factors: (i) cross-country differences in the number of sources in which a country appears, and (ii) differences in the precision of the sources in which each country appears.
